Spend a few days in Broken Hill, an artists mecca. The Silver City has a rich frontier history and today is a fascinating mix of both mining town and artist's community. It's a great bease from which to explore the true outback. Discover the beautiful Menindee Lakes, the Mutawintji National Park, home to one of the best collections of aboriginal rock art in Australia. Broken Hill is the starting point for many tours into the News South Wales outback and across the border into South Australia. Visit iconic places such as Milparinka, Tibooburra, Camerons Corner, the spectacular Flinders Ranges, Arkaroola and Wilpena Pound, the remote Strzlecki Track and the glorious Sturt National Park.
